How is a tree frog different from a pond frog?

Tree Frogs live in trees all around the world. They have suction cups on their toes to allow them to grip the tree bark. Tree Frogs are usually smaller in size. Pond Frogs live near water and have webbed feet for swimming. These frogs can get very large.

Why do you think frogs live in the pond?

Amphibians need water to lay their eggs so that they come to maturity through the tadpole stage. Other reasons, but reproduction is the most important reason for amphibians such as frogs.
